Leading off round two, as they did for round one, we find the Houston Texans, this time with our Dan Turczynski playing the role of their GM.
Pick #33: Houston Texans (Dan)
Demarcus Lawrence, DE/OLB, Boise State
Dan's comments:
After passing on Jadeveon Clowney with the No. 1 overall pick, the Texans get an athlete and an overall very versatile player who can play a number of different positions for new D-Coordinator Romeo Crennel.

Pick #34: Washington Redskins (Aron)
Calvin Pryor, S, Louisville
Here's Aron's reasoning:
This is a good spot for Pryor in this draft. Ryan Clark should be able to help him improve for the starting gig at the start of next year.
Since they traded away their 1st-round pick to St. Louis, this is the Redskins first selection in this year's draft.
Pick #35: Cleveland Browns (Tex)
Ja'Wuan James, OT, Tennessee
Here is what I had to say on this pick:
After adding Manziel and Benjamin, the Browns need to protect them. James is the top tackle remaining on the board and should be solid opposite Joe Thomas.
